Banner Image

Skills

  • Data Science
  • Machine Learning
  • Classification
  • Clustering
  • Data Mining
  • Operations Research
  • Planning
  • Problem Solving
  • Regression
  • Routing
  • Scheduling

Services

  • Data Mining

    $50/hr Starting at $300 Ongoing

    Dedicated Resource

    Extracting knowledge and insights from structured or raw data. This service typically includes accessing data sources, preprocessing, mining, compiling and presenting results.

    Data MiningData Science
  • Machine Learning

    $50/hr Starting at $300 Ongoing

    Dedicated Resource

    Fitting non-linear functions for classification or regression. This service typically includes accessing data sources, data preprocessing, model selection, and network training and evaluation.

    ClassificationClusteringData ScienceMachine LearningRegression
  • Optimization problem solving

    $50/hr Starting at $300 Ongoing

    Dedicated Resource

    Solve non-linear mathematical problems. This service typically includes modeling, testing different solvers, and fine tuning - developing relaxations and heuristics to guide the solver towards the solution...

    Machine LearningOperations ResearchPlanningProblem SolvingRouting

About

For the past 17 years I have been learning, researching, teaching, and applying Artificial Intelligence techniques for decision and optimization, machine learning, data mining and knowledge representation.

EMPLOYMENT HISTORY

Since 2017 I'm a Senior Data Scientist contractor at National Pharmacy Association (ANF) where I design and develop algorithms for predicting customer retention, semantic interpretation of textual medical prescriptions, predicting pharmacy daily stock, among others.
(corporate website: http://www.revistasauda.pt/conheca-nos/Pages/default.aspx)

Since 2015 I'm a researcher and developer at TheSolvingMachine where I design and develop of a cloud based solution for planning pickup/delivery transportation activities involving multiple vehicles, time and resource constraints.
(product website: https://thesolvingmachine.com/kangrouter)

EDUCATION

In 2004 I got a MSc degree from Universidade Nova de Lisboa, Lisbon, with the thesis "Heuristic Search for Protein Structure Determination".

In 2010 I got a PhD degree in Constraint Optimization, from Universidade Nova de Lisboa, Lisbon, with the thesis "Modern Techniques for Constraint Solving".

RESEARCH

As a researcher I have a published a number of papers in peer-reviewed journals and conferences. Here are three examples:

A certified Branch & Bound approach for reliability-based optimization problems.
https://link.springer.com/article/10.1007/s10898-017-0529-6

From phenotype to genotype in complex brain networks.
https://www.nature.com/articles/srep19790

View-based propagation of decomposable constraints.
https://link.springer.com/article/10.1007/s10601-013-9140-8

SOFTWARE

I'm also an active software developer. Some contributions:

CaSPER, the Constraint Solving Platform for Engineering and Research. https://github.com/marcovc/casper

PROCURE,Probabilistic Constraints for Uncertainty Reasoning in Science and Engineering Applications.
https://github.com/marcovc/procure

Work Terms

9:00-18:00 GMT